In order to have 'soil', as opposed to 'dirt', one must view the entire
garden as a living entity.
A biomass, a biological mass of living interconnected and associated
entities; whether they be macro-organisms like worms and beetles,
micro-organisms like bacteria and viruses, or fungi.
An organic garden should be evolution on a molecular scale. The mulch
and manure that were applied to one crop, including the remnants of
that crop, now partly decomposed, become the base to initiate the
evolution of the biomass.
Some bacterias, feeding on the spent plant material, will attract
organisms that feed on them and their debris, like fungi; which in turn
attracts organisms that feed on fungi, whose debris then feeds the
bacteria, again. As this molecular mass of waste, called seed compost,
builds up with the subsequent applications of mulch, manures and
plantings, other organisms are attracted also, nematodes, various
insects, worms - all of which, in their turn are consumed by some other
organism - adding to the mass.
Slowly, incrementally, the biomass builds, worms transport soil,
bacteria and trace elements around the garden; deep-rooted plants plumb
the depths for trace elements, which are then deposited higher in the
soil as that plant decomposes, making these elements now more readily
available to other plants; in turn releasing them back into biomass for
some other organism.
The greater, or more evolved the biomass in soil becomes, the greater
the number of plants that can be incorporated into the garden, and in
turn returned to the soil, continuing the cycle.
Provided that a garden is added to with organic material, during and
after each crop, and re-planted with a diversity of plants and herbs
filling any spaces (no bare soil), it will only get better over time -
like a stew.
An important rule to remember is - that which comes out of a garden,
must be replaced, in some form.
So, if you have just dug up all the potatoes, replace that crop with an
equal weight of mulch and manure. Balance is what we are trying to
achieve.
Interestingly, an organic garden never reaches critical mass. It is
never going to increase enormously in bulk, nor slowly encroach on your
house and attack you one night.
A balanced organic garden has its own highs and lows, when one organism
or element becomes too profuse, this then triggers a population
increase in whichever organism feeds on it, and so on, until balance is
re-established.
Having stated that critical mass is never reached, I should state that
rather, self perpetuation is reached instead. By this I mean that, when
a good balance is reached, the garden produces enough raw plant
material, animal manures and debris, ultimately returned to the garden,
that it perpetuates itself.

Fertilization 101: Growing Vegetables in Your Organic Garden
When we talk of fertilization for your effective gardening of vegetables in your organic gardening, it is almost similarly attributed to mulching. But there are also other aspects such as the introduction of fertilizers that can be available naturally or commercially. Simply defined, it involves placing matter, whether organic or inorganic, around your plants.
Aside from providing fertilization, it also protects your soil. Whether your garden is subjected under heavy rains or at the risk of weed infestation, the mulches provide ample protection and strengthening needed to supplement the natural growth processes of your organic garden vegetables. Aside from this, it also regulates the temperature of the soil; it can also render aesthetic appeal to the garden because it will help improve the ground texture and overall appearance.
If you have effectively established mulches in your garden, less watering is required because it will also help the plants retain water. The plants will also experience better growth levels and moisture retention. Although known to help in weed control, it does not directly fight or ward off the weeds. It just helps as a filler for bare areas that are at higher risk of weed infestation. Also, persistent weeds can die down as it forces itself in the soil surrounded with mulch.
For the case of organic mulches, bacteria has the tendency to eat up the much-needed nitrogen, so in some cases, you might be required to inject additional dosages of nitrogen. Some examples of materials you can use for mulching include lawn clippings, compost mises, leaves, straw, sawdust, wood chips. These are examples of organic materials for mulching. If you opt for inorganic, it often has its optimum results on plants placed on a hill.
When fertilizing your soil via mulching, you may be required to be more meticulous with your organic garden. You might be required to water more frequently when you are using inorganic fabrics, and then you must also watch out for the greater tendency to wilt because the ground cover tends to be more crowded.
Testing your soil is a good way to ensure effective fertilization. you cannot afford to buy fertilizer by the bulk, only to realize that it is not the right fertilizer suited for your soil. The best way to make sure that you are able to score the best fertilizer is by means of doing an actual test on a sample of soil taken from your garden.
Once you apply fertilizer, it is often recommended to maintain it. Having a budget for high quality fertilizer is also a good must-have for a gardener, especially a beginner. There are also some fertilizers solely tailored at the beginning of the planting process and need not be maintained all throughout your gardening activities. In any rate, make sure that you are getting your money's worth and have thoroughly proven for yourself that the given fertilizer you are putting on your garden has been tried and tested on your soil type.
Even if you put fertilizers or inorganic mulches in your soil, the organic matter is still the best source of fertilization for your plant, and it adheres closely to the natural growth process of plants. If at all possible, avoid introducing too much chemical interventions in your soil so that the plants will get used to growing and maximizing its potential via natural means.

Sustainable Organic Vegetable Gardening With Organic Matter
Sustainable organic vegetable gardening can only happen if people know how to use and prepare organic matter.
This is because it improves the soil and prevents it from compacting and crusting. It increases the water’s holding ability so earthworms and other microorganisms can aerate the soil and it slows down erosion and in later stages of decay so that organic matter is able to release nitrogen and other nutrients which help the crops grow.
Such a technique is old but is now making a come back because the conventional method of using synthetic materials like fertilizer and pesticides have ruined the soil and depleted it or organic matter so this cannot be used for replanting.
So where do we get this organic matter? Believe it or not, the best form of organic matter comes from animal manure. The fresher the better because you can apply this directly to the soil but this should only be done in the fall and plowed down to give it adequate time for sufficient breakdown and ammonia to release before the planting season begins.
If you don’t have access to fresh animal manure, you can use the dried version that is being sold in nurseries and garden stores.
For those who don’t to use manure, you can use compost instead. This can be made from lawn clippings, leaves, food waste and other plant materials. It is cheap but its nutrient content is very low.
There is another kind of manure better known as green manure You don’t use any waste by animals here but rather growing a cover crop in your garden and then plowing it under so you are adding organic matter to the soil. The best way to maximize this is for you not to use the garden for one season.
You can also seed the green manure in the fall and then turn it under with a plow or a large tiller in the early spring. That way, you can use your garden normally while at the same time building up the soil.
Annual ryegrass is a good example for green manuring and covering. THIs should be seeded 1 to 2 feet per 1,000 square feet. If this is not available, you can use seed rye or wheat and place it 3 to 4 feet per 1,000 square feet. This helps prevent weeds from growing and in order for this to be effective, wait at least 2 weeks before you start planting.
Sewage sludge is also a good source of organic matter. There are two types namely digested sludge and dried activated sludge.
The first is relatively low quality. It contains from 1 to 3 percent of nitrogen and should only be applied during the fall. But you should be careful when you use it because it sometimes contain metal ions that are not good to use on vegetable gardens.
The second which is the dried activated sludge has been separated from coarse solids, inoculated with microorganisms and aerated. This is better than the other one because it is filtered, dried in kilns and screened. It contains 5 to 6 percent of nitrogen and 5 to 7 pounds can cover an area of 100 square feet.
Take note that these two types are different from raw sewage. That being said, never use that to garden any soil.
Sustainable organic vegetable gardening can only happen with organic matter. Now that you know this, choose from manure, compost or sludge.

Watering of Your Vegetable Organic Garden
With vegetables, you cannot afford to go wrong since this will provide nourishment to both animals and humans alike. Water also acts a supplementary source aside from rainfall.
An irrigation system is necessary to provide the required amount of water in your garden. The natural sources of water, namely, precipitation and underground water systems, are not often sufficient for the plants. Most of the time, human intervention is required to ensure that the plants will reach their maximum potential. The frequency of your watering is proportional to the average amount of rainfall that falls on the area under which your garden lies.
The type of soil also affects the quality of plants' water retention. The soils made of clay are usually lauded for its excellent ability to hold water in, but sometimes it goes overboard, so caution is required. Sandy sieves require more assistance as they tend to slide off the water being placed on it. The addition of organic matter such as a composting mix also helps improve the ability to hold water.
There are also other external factors affecting the nature of watering in your garden. During cold weather, the plants can easily drown in water and wilt. On the other hand, the plants require more water when there is a surplus of sunlight or humidity levels. The factors of wind and air movement can also move the water from the plants. Also, the type of plant can affect the capacity to hold water. More mature plants may find it more difficult to retain water than the younger counterparts.
When watering the plants, make sure that you are able to soak the soil thoroughly before doing anything else. Another thing to consider is observing the plants at different times of day. Usually, plants look more wilted at night time, but this is natural and won't usually require excessive watering. The balance is usually obtained the following day. But if you see the plant wilted during daytime, it is best to soak it with water to avoid it from wilting completely.
Often, vegetables picked from well-watered plants last longer than their less watered counterparts. Unless you are growing a cactus, water need not be used sparingly. There are various ways to water your plants: by a sprinkler that is manually controlled or automated, by hose or other means. Often, the sprinkler is the most famous form of watering tool. Proper scheduling of the frequency of your water sprinklers' operations will also ensure that your plants will be consistently watered at different times of day.
It is also recommended that uniform distribution of water be maintained in order to ensure that all the plants in your vegetables' organic garden are well-cared for. Despite the need for frequent watering, also bear in mind that there is also a need to conserve water, so make sure that there are no leaks whatsoever beyond what your organic garden needs.
